As far as Springfield frames made in Brazil. Made at Forjas Imbel. Imbel has been a name I've trusted for quality FAL parts, and receivers, for many years. They are THE producer of Fals and 1911s for the Brazilian governement for decades. I've always had good luck with Springfield/Imbel 1911s. They make a solid product.
